Using UPnP (Universal Plug and Play)

UPnP can automatically configure your router to be accessed from the Internet. In
order to use this feature, your router needs to support this feature and it must be
enabled. Most router manufacturers disable this feature as the default setting. See
http://panasonic.co.jp/pcc/products/en/netwkcam/ for details and see your
router manual for how to enable UPnP. After the UPnP is enabled on the router, set
[Enable] for auto port forwarding.
1.
Click [UPnP] on the Setup page.
2.
Set up UPnP.
Setting
Auto Port
Forwarding
Display Shortcut
Icon in My
Network Places
3.
Click [Save] when finished.
New settings are saved.
When finished, "Success!" is displayed.
4.
Click [Go to UPnP page].
The UPnP page is displayed.

If the network setting is [Static] or [DHCP], enabling auto
port forwarding allows you to access the camera from the
Internet.
Note
If the network setting is [Automatic Setup], enable [Allow
Access from the Internet] on the Network page (see page
30).
Enabling it displays a shortcut to the camera in the My
Network Places folder.
Note
If you use Windows XP or Windows Me, this feature is
available. Enable UPnP Windows component before using
this feature (see page 95).
